These were my readings from 10-20-10,
pH 6.6
Ammonia 0 ppm
Nitrite 0 ppm
Nitrate 5.0 ppm

These are my readings before my water change today,
pH 7.6
Ammonia 0 ppm
Nitrite 0 ppm
Nitrate 10 ppm

And after the water change,
pH 7.6
Ammonia 0 ppm
Nitrite 0 ppm
Nitrate 5.0 ppm

So my pH jumped up 1.0 and my Nitrates went up 5.0 ppm to 10 ppm in 5 days but after the water change went back to 5.0 ppm and my pH stayed at 7.6 were it was at before the water change.

So what levels are ok for the nitrates? Is less than 40 ppm acceptable in a 14 gallon tank?
